@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.description",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@ImmutableInfo(value="true")
@Since(value="12.2.1.0.0")
@Visibility(value=Advanced)
@SystemMBean
public interface ConfigurationMXBean
| Modifier and Type | Field and Description |
|---|---|
static java.lang.String |
RBN |
| Modifier and Type | Method and Description |
|---|---|
java.lang.String[] |
getAllServiceTypes()
Returns all service types can be managed by Enterprise Manager.
|
boolean |
isRestartRequired()
Returns the flag indicates restart of tenant/global is required to make OPSS service changes to take effect
|
PortablePropertyMetadata[] |
listSecurityStorePropertyMetadata()
Returns meta data for security store properties
|
PortablePropertyMetadata[] |
listServicePropertyMetadata(java.lang.String serviceType)
Returns meta data for properties of given service type
|
PortableProperty[] |
querySecurityStoreProperties()
Returns all properties for security store
|
PortableProperty[] |
queryServiceProperties(java.lang.String serviceType)
Returns all properties defined for given service type explicitly.
|
void |
updateSecurityStoreProperties(PortableProperty[] pps)
Sets properties for security store.
|
void |
updateServiceProperties(java.lang.String serviceType, PortableProperty[] pps)
Sets service properties.
|
static final java.lang.String RBN
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.listSecurityStorePropertyMetadata",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
PortablePropertyMetadata[] listSecurityStorePropertyMetadata()
throws oracle.as.jmx.framework.exceptions.ManagementException
o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.querySecurityStoreProperties",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
PortableProperty[] querySecurityStoreProperties()
throws oracle.as.jmx.framework.exceptions.ManagementException
o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.updateSecurityStoreProperties",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=1)
@RequireRestart(value=ContainerRestart)
void updateSecurityStoreProperties(PortableProperty[] pps)
throws oracle.as.jmx.framework.exceptions.ManagementException
pps -o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.listServicePropertyMetadata",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
PortablePropertyMetadata[] listServicePropertyMetadata(java.lang.String serviceType)
throws oracle.as.jmx.framework.exceptions.ManagementException
serviceType -o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.getAllServiceTypes",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
java.lang.String[] getAllServiceTypes()
throws oracle.as.jmx.framework.exceptions.ManagementException
o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.queryServiceProperties",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
PortableProperty[] queryServiceProperties(java.lang.String serviceType)
throws oracle.as.jmx.framework.exceptions.ManagementException
serviceType -o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.isRestartRequired",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=0)
boolean isRestartRequired()
throws oracle.as.jmx.framework.exceptions.ManagementException
oracle.as.jmx.framework.exceptions.ManagementException
@Description(resourceKey="oracle.security.jps.management.ConfigurationMXBean.updateServiceProperties",
resourceBundleBasename="oracle_security_jps_mas_mgmt_util_JpsManagementMessages")
@Impact(value=1)
@RequireRestart(value=ContainerRestart)
void updateServiceProperties(java.lang.String serviceType,
PortableProperty[] pps)
throws oracle.as.jmx.framework.exceptions.ManagementException
serviceType -pps -oracle.as.jmx.framework.exceptions.ManagementException